A sales trainer is a professional who specializes in providing training and guidance to sales teams or individuals to enhance their selling skills, increase productivity, and achieve sales targets. They design and deliver training programs that focus on various aspects of the sales process, including prospecting, lead generation, negotiation, closing deals, and building client relationships. Sales trainers assess the strengths and weaknesses of salespeople and tailor their training methods accordingly, using techniques such as role-playing, interactive workshops, and one-on-one coaching sessions. They also stay updated with the latest sales strategies and industry trends to ensure that the training content remains relevant and effective.

Sales Trainer salary in Saudi Arabia
Average Yearly Salary of Sales Trainer in Saudi Arabia is approximately 144,100 SAR (36,057 USD). Data is for 2025 and indicates a pre-tax value. The salary itself depends on multiple factors such as seniority, job performance, certifications, experience or any other bonuses. The value indicated is an average amount based on records we have in database. Real values may vary. The data is for orientational purposes.

Saudi Arabia, officially known as the Kingdom of Saudi Arabia, is a country located in the Middle East. With a population of approximately 34 million people, it is the 40th most populous country in the world. The nation covers an area of about 2.15 million square kilometers, making it the 13th largest country globally. Saudi Arabia is bordered by Jordan and Iraq to the north, Kuwait to the northeast, Qatar, Bahrain, and the United Arab Emirates to the east, Oman to the southeast, and Yemen to the south.
Estimated national average yearly salary is 103,462 SAR (27,590 USD). Value indicated is pre-tax. Below graph shows estimated Sales Trainer job salary compared to average salary in Saudi Arabia.
Comparison shows that a person working as Sales Trainer in Saudi Arabia earns on average:
1.39 times the average salary (or 139% of average salary).
